Seamless Integration of OnVIF-Compliant GigE Cameras
The interoperability of different devices is a common challenge in hospital systems. OnVIF (Open Network Video Interface Forum) compliance ensures that GigE cameras can integrate seamlessly with various video management systems (VMS) and other security devices. This means that hospitals can enhance their surveillance infrastructure without worrying about compatibility issues. Healthcare facilities can implement a robust and flexible surveillance system that meets their specific needs, improving both security and patient care.
